titleOfInvention | Thermoplastic composition and trim parts for automobile interior |
abstract | Α-methylstyrene high content ABS resin (B) and / or maleimide having a glass transition temperature of 5 to 55% by weight of the copolymer (A) having a temperature of 0 ° C. or lower and a heat deformation temperature (18.6 kg / cm 2 load) of 100 ° C. or more. It provides a thermoplastic resin composition characterized in that the Izod impact strength (23 ℃) made of 95 to 45% by weight of the ABS resin (C) is 10kgcm / cm or more.n n n The deformation at the high temperature is small, the stress at the time of impact is small, and therefore, the molded article with a large absorbed energy at the time of impact is provided, and it is suitable for the interior trim of an automobile. |
